In a Shariah state where adultery, promiscuity are prohibited, using public funds to facilitate marriage is a component of good governance

In a Shariah state where adultery, promiscuity are prohibited, using public funds to facilitate marriage is a component of good governance - Sheik Gumi

Popular Islamic cleric, Sheik Gumi, has backed the mass weddings carried out by some Northern state governors.

 

In a post shared on Facebook, Gumi said in a Shariah state where prostitution, fornication, adultery, and promiscuity are prohibited, using public funds to facilitate the marriage of women who are in excess is a legitimate and responsible component of good governance.
